Hello to all, I'm wondering if there is a way to apply attributes introduced with html5. I would like to set the "download" attribute for an anchor: e.g.
<a id="tex2html1" href="some_document.pdf" download >download course 1</a> I would like to use \htmladdnormallink[download]{download course 1}{some_document.pdf} or \htmladdnormallink[download=name-for-client.pdf]{download course 1}{document_name.pdf} I was playing around with\HTML code command, but did not succeed. <!--Converted with LaTeX2HTML 2020 (Released January 1, 2020) --> using html5_0.pl Any hint is appreciated Christian Mensing
